Quick & easy stopgap for CVE-2014-3689:  We just compile out the
hardware acceleration functions which lack sanity checks.  Thankfully
we have capability bits for them (SVGA_CAP_RECT_COPY and
SVGA_CAP_RECT_FILL), so guests should deal just fine, in theory.

Subsequent patches will add the missing checks and re-enable the
hardware acceleration emulation.

Add verification function for rectangles, returning
true if verification passes and false otherwise.

+static inline bool vmsvga_verify_rect(DisplaySurface *surface,
+                                      const char *name,
+                                      int x, int y, int w, int h)
+{
+    if (x < 0)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: x was < 0 (%d)\n", name, x);
+        return false;
+    }
+    if (x > SVGA_MAX_WIDTH)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: x was > %d (%d)\n", name, SVGA_MAX_WIDTH, x);
+        return false;
+    }
+    if (w < 0)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: w was < 0 (%d)\n", name, w);
+        return false;
+    }
+    if (w > SVGA_MAX_WIDTH)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: w was > %d (%d)\n", name, SVGA_MAX_WIDTH, w);
+        return false;
+    }
+    if (x + w > surface_width(surface))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: width was > %d (x: %d, w: %d)\n",
+                name, surface_width(surface), x, w);
+        return false;
+    }
+
+    if (y < 0)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: y was < 0 (%d)\n", name, y);
+        return false;
+    }
+    if (y > SVGA_MAX_HEIGHT)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: y was > %d (%d)\n", name, SVGA_MAX_HEIGHT, y);
+        return false;
+    }
+    if (h < 0)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: h was < 0 (%d)\n", name, h);
+        return false;
+    }
+    if (h > SVGA_MAX_HEIGHT)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: h was > %d (%d)\n", name, SVGA_MAX_HEIGHT, h);
+        return false;
+    }
+    if (y + h > surface_height(surface)) {
+        fprintf(stderr, "%s: update height > %d (y: %d, h: %d)\n",
+                name, surface_height(surface), y, h);
+        return false;
+    }
+
+    return true;
+}

Switch vmsvga_update_rect over to use vmsvga_verify_rect.  Slight change
in behavior:  We don't try to automatically fixup rectangles any more.
In case we find invalid update requests we'll do a full-screen update
instead.
